This smoothie is one of the easiest meals to consume during the first 24 hours after your Ozempic injection — no chewing required, no cooking, and blended in under 2 minutes. Banana provides potassium to replenish electrolytes lost through injection-day nausea, while ginger is clinically recognized for calming the nausea that semaglutide commonly causes. Unsweetened almond milk keeps fat content low, as high fat dramatically worsens GLP-1-related side effects. Avoid adding protein powders, peanut butter, or full-fat dairy on injection day. This smooth, drinkable meal is gentle enough even when your appetite is nearly gone.
Peel and freeze banana ahead of time (or use a fresh banana with extra ice).
Add frozen banana, almond milk, grated ginger, and honey to a blender.
Add 3 ice cubes.
Blend on high for 30–45 seconds until completely smooth.
Pour into a glass and sip slowly.
